Catechism of the Catholic Church and the Catholic Bible
The catechism serves as a text that provides a comprehensive overview of the key elements of Christian doctrine, encompassing both faith and moral teachings.
For the Catholic Church, its catechisms primarily draw upon the Church's Tradition, interpreted in the context of Vatican II. The principal sources include Sacred Scripture, the Church Fathers, Liturgy, and the Magisterium. The catechism is intended to act "as a reference point for the catechisms or compendia created in various nations" (Synod of Bishops 1985. Final Report II B A 4).
A more extensive version was released on October 11, 1992, by John Paul II, along with the Compendium, which was introduced by Pope Benedict XVI on June 28, 2005. This Compendium faithfully summarizes the Catechism of the Catholic Church, presenting all fundamental aspects of the Church's faith succinctly. It aims to serve as "a kind of vademecum through which individuals, whether believers or not, can grasp the complete landscape of the Catholic faith," as described by the Pope.

FAQ
Is the Catechism meant to replace the Bible?
No, the Catechismserves as a companion to the Bible, explaining how Scripture is understood and lived within the Catholic Tradition.
How is the Catechism organized?
It is divided into four main parts: The Profession of Faith (Creed), The Celebration of the Christian Mystery (Sacraments), Life in Christ (Morality), and Christian Prayer.
Can non-Catholics benefit from these texts?
Absolutely. Both the Catechismand the Catholic Bibleoffer insight into the history, beliefs, and spiritual practices of the Catholic Church, making them valuable for anyone interested in Christian thought.
Is there a digital version available?
Yes, the Catechismand the Bibleare widely available in digital formats, including apps and websites, often with search functions and cross-references.
What’s the difference between the full Catechism and the Compendium?
The Compendiumis a shorter, simplified version of the Catechism, presented in a Q&A format ideal for beginners or quick consultation.
